Value Chain Analysis Raw Material Sourcing Foam head positioners rely on high-density, medical-grade polyurethane or polyethylene foams, sourced from specialized chemical suppliers. Suppliers focus on quality, biocompatibility, and sterilization compatibility. Manufacturing Manufacturing involves foam cutting, molding, assembly, and quality testing. South Korea boasts advanced manufacturing facilities with automation and ISO 13485 compliance, ensuring high precision and safety standards. Distribution & Logistics Distribution channels include direct hospital supply contracts, medical device distributors, and online platforms. Logistics emphasize cold chain management for sterilized products and timely delivery to healthcare providers. Adoption Trends & End-User Insights Major end-user segments include: Hospitals & Diagnostic Centers: Rapid adoption driven by need for precision and safety. Specialty Clinics & Outpatient Facilities: Growing preference for portable, cost-effective solutions. Research & Academic Institutions: Use of advanced, customizable foam positioners for experimental procedures. Use cases encompass MRI head stabilization, CT imaging, neurosurgical positioning, and ENT procedures. The shift towards minimally invasive and outpatient procedures is increasing demand for ergonomic and adaptable solutions.
